This detailed analysis examines the nearly decade-long process of preparing and negotiating the accession of Eastern, Southeastern, and Central European countries, along with Mediterranean nations, to the European Union, culminating in the accession of ten countries in 2004 and two more in 2007. Authored by two diplomats directly involved, the text shares first-hand insights into the closed-door proceedings that shaped the EU's enlargement policy. A dedicated chapter outlines the Accession Process and the Union's strategy for preparing candidate countries legally and economically for membership. The authors meticulously detail the complex negotiations from 1998 to 2002, highlighting the roles of EU member states and the European Commission. They also analyze the future prospects for EU accession by Balkan nations and Turkey. Key issues addressed include the free movement of workers, agriculture, financing, transport, and nuclear safety, alongside discussions on Kaliningrad and the Stability and Association Pact for Southeast Europe. This volume not only provides essential information about the enlargement process but also serves as a case study of European policies and diplomatic practices, offering valuable insights into the workings of EU institutions and member state representatives. It will appeal to those interested in European politics, international organizations, and area studies.

The European Union has faced a significant period of rising anti-EU sentiments and challenges in implementing renewed socio-economic governance. Amidst this backdrop, European institutions have engaged in discussions aimed at overcoming recession and revitalizing integration. Despite many Member States adhering to strict austerity measures--while 27 million Europeans remain unemployed and a quarter of the population faces poverty--there is a consensus among stakeholders, particularly the trade union movement, on the necessity of an EU-driven growth strategy. This 2013 edition of Social developments in the European Union offers essential insights from analysts and scholars. Contributors critically assess recent EU economic governance and propose guidelines for a strengthened EU social protection and investment plan. Key proposals include a pan-European unemployment insurance scheme and an EU minimum income scheme, alongside an emphasis on the gender dimension in social policies. Additionally, the volume reviews national labor market policy reforms. Although the European economy remains bleak, the proposed institutional and policy reforms present an opportunity to forge a new path for Europe.
